UNIVERSAL ONE GALLON JUG BY FRARY & CLARK MADE IN THE USA IN NEW BRITAIN CONN.ALL METAL DARK GREEN EXTERIOR WITH A HEAVY CROCK POT TYPE CERAMIC INSIDEKEEPS FOODS HOT OR COLD WITH AIR TIGHT LID AND SCREW ON ALUMINUM BOWL/CUP HAS METAL HANDLE WITH GOOD CONDITION WOODEN GRAB BARBOTTOM IS MARKED PATENT PENDING WHICH I HAVE LEARNED WAS APPLIED FOR MARCH 1917THESE WERE COMMONLY USED BY THE MINERS TO KEEP THEIR FOOD CLEAN AND FROM SPOILINGA PIECE OF HISTORY MANUFACTURED TO LAST A LIFETIME AS THIS ONE HASGOOD CONDITION OVERALL SOME MINOR SURFACE STUFF AS PICTURED CERAMIC INSIDE IS PERFECT AND CLEAN AS PICTUREDA COUPLE VERY SMALL DINGS IN THE ALUMINUM BOWL HARDLY WORTH MENTIONINGUNIT WEIGHS 9 LBS STAMPED NO. 1295 ON BOTTOM GREAT FOR HUNTING , CAMPING, WORK, YOU NAME IT
